This is THE sauce. San Marzano tomatoes, fresh basil, garlic, and olive oil — nothing more, nothing less. This 20-minute recipe has been perfected over generations.
Featured Recipe
Open the can and crush San Marzano tomatoes by hand or pulse briefly in a food processor. Leave some chunks for texture.
Heat olive oil in a saucepan over medium heat. Add minced garlic and cook for 30 seconds until fragrant, but don't let it brown.
Add crushed tomatoes, salt, and pepper. Reduce heat to low and simmer for 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ally.
Remove from heat and stir in fresh basil. Let cool slightly before spreading on pizza dough.
Pro Tip: For smoother sauce, blend before adding basil. For chunky texture, leave as is.

Essential tips for perfect pizza sauce every time
Always simmer on low heat. High heat cooks off flavors and can make sauce too thick. 15-25 minutes is ideal.
Use fresh basil instead of dried. Fresh garlic over powder. Fresh ingredients make all the difference!
Look for DOP certified San Marzano tomatoes from Italy. Sweeter, less acidic, and genuinely authentic.
Add a pinch of sugar or a splash of honey if your sauce tastes too acidic. Or use roasted tomatoes!
Let sauce cool for 10 minutes before spreading on dough. Hot sauce will start cooking the dough!
Use extra virgin olive oil for finishing. It adds depth and richness that regular olive oil can't match.
